From 74a7025f6c709fa7a21de68ac9fd2fb1ef7eb278 Mon Sep 17 00:00:00 2001 From: caoqianming Date: Thu, 20 Feb 2025 17:02:36 +0800 Subject: [PATCH] =?UTF-8?q?feat:=20wm=5Fin=20=E5=9C=A8mlogbin=E6=97=B6?= =?UTF-8?q?=E5=BF=85=E5=A1=AB?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- apps/wpm/serializers.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/apps/wpm/serializers.py b/apps/wpm/serializers.py index 6ccbf7eb..e914e925 100644 --- a/apps/wpm/serializers.py +++ b/apps/wpm/serializers.py @@ -539,6 +539,8 @@ class MlogbInSerializer(CustomModelSerializer): if mtask and mtask.state != Mtask.MTASK_ASSGINED: raise ValidationError('该任务非下达中不可选择') wm_in: WMaterial = attrs['wm_in'] + if wm_in is None: + raise ParseError("请选择相应车间库存!") if wm_in.state in [WMaterial.WM_OK, WMaterial.WM_REPAIR]: pass else: